Oracle Report Developer @ AMS CWS [£50,000 – 70,000]

  • UK

Salary: £50,000 – 70,000 per year

Requirements:

  • Experience with Oracle BI Publisher and related Oracle reporting tools
  • Strong experience with Oracle SQL and PL/SQL
  • Knowledge of Oracle ERP database architecture and table structures
  • Familiarity with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) and Oracle Cloud deployments
  • Exposure to ETL tools or reporting automation tools
  • Experience with Oracle APEX, Fusion Analytics, or similar platforms
  • Experience working within Agile or ITIL environments

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and maintain reports primarily using Oracle BI Publisher and related tools
  • Develop complex data models and report layouts aligned to business requirements
  • Write and optimise SQL and PL/SQL queries, procedures, and packages for reporting purposes
  • Ensure report accuracy, data consistency, and alignment with defined business rules
  • Tune report performance and optimise database queries
  • Ensure efficient data retrieval and processing for large datasets
  • Support report deployment across development, test, and production environments
  • Participate in unit testing, system testing, user acceptance testing (UAT), and production cutover activities
  • Troubleshoot and resolve report-related issues and defects
  • Provide ongoing support, enhancements, and maintenance for existing reports
  • Collaborate with functional teams, DBAs, and application developers
